Typical A/c Issues and Repairing Is your sanctuary feeling more like a sauna? Don't sweat it! Let's dive into some typical air conditioner adversaries and how to tackle them. Low Refrigerant: The Quiet Killer Low refrigerant is a regular offender behind weak cooling. Believe of refrigerant as the lifeblood of your a/c; without enough, it can't efficiently transfer heat. Leaks are frequently the cause, and these need professional attention. Simply including more refrigerant isn't a repair; it resembles patching a dripping tire indefinitely. You'll need a refrigerant leak detection and repair work. Dirty Air Filters: The Tricky Saboteur I when knew a house owner who grumbled his air conditioner was constantly running however barely cooling. Turns out, his air filter hadn't been altered in ... years! A dirty air filter restricts airflow, forcing your a/c to work more difficult and less effectively. It's an easy repair: Change your air filter every 1-3 months (more frequently if you have family pets or allergies) Use the correct filter size (check your a/c system's manual) Consider a greater MERV ranking filter for better air quality. Frozen Evaporator Coil: An Icy Hassle A frozen evaporator coil is often a sign of low airflow or low refrigerant. When air flow is restricted, the coil gets too cold and ice forms. Turn off your air conditioner and let the coil thaw totally. Examine your air filter and look for any obstructions obstructing air flow. If the issue persists, it's most likely a refrigerant problem needing expert attention. Capacitor Issues: The Starting Difficulty The capacitor helps begin and run the AC's motor. If it stops working, your AC may have a hard time to switch on or run intermittently. A stopping working capacitor can sometimes be identified by a bulging or dripping appearance. This is a task finest delegated a qualified specialist. Drainage Issues: The Soggy Situation Your a/c produces condensation, which needs to drain properly. If the drain line is blocked, water can back up and cause leakages and even damage to your system. You can attempt clearing the drain line yourself with a wet/dry vacuum or a stiff wire. Find the drain line (normally a PVC pipe near the outdoor system) Use a wet/dry vacuum to draw here out any clogs. Pour a cup of vinegar down the drain line to avoid future buildup. Outside System Fan Problems: Getting Too Hot Issues The fan on your outside AC system assists dissipate heat. If the fan isn't working properly, your AC can get too hot and shut down. Examine for any blockages blocking the fan blades, and make certain the fan motor is running efficiently. If not, you might need a fan motor replacement. When to Call a Pro: While some a/c troubleshooting can be do it yourself, particular problems require an expert touch. If you're uncomfortable dealing with electrical parts or refrigerants, it's always best to call a certified air conditioner service technician.

Typical A/c Disorders and Specialist Solutions

From refrigerant leaks to compressor failures, the list of possible AC issues can appear overwhelming. A typical problem is a frozen evaporator coil, frequently triggered by limited air flow. Did you understand that something as basic as a filthy air filter can lead to this? Another frequent offender is a stopping working capacitor, which can avoid the compressor or fan motor from beginning. Attending to these problems immediately can prevent them from escalating into more substantial, expensive repair work. It is likewise crucial to understand that some problems such as a refrigerant leakage can be triggered by something as simple as a little hole in a copper line.

The Art of Refrigerant Recharge

Refrigerant is the lifeline of your air conditioner system, and a leakage can significantly affect its cooling effectiveness. Here's a crucial point: merely adding more refrigerant isn't constantly the answer. A responsible professional will first locate and repair the leak before recharging the system. This guarantees that the issue is fixed permanently, preventing further refrigerant loss and ecological harm. When handling refrigerant, it is very important to be conscious of the different kinds of refrigerant that are offered and what are permitted to be utilized, and how they affect the performance and performance of the a/c system.

The Nuts And Bolts of Preventative Steps

Preventative measures are not simply about preventing significant breakdowns; they have to do with enhancing your unit's performance and extending its life expectancy. Have you ever considered that a disregarded air conditioning system can actually increase your energy costs? That's right, an unclean filter or clogged up coil forces your system to work harder, guzzling more electrical power while doing so. It's like running a marathon with ankle weights!

Basic Actions, Considerable Cost Savings

  • Air Filter Replacement: This is the single crucial thing you can do. Go for every 1-3 months, depending upon use and air quality. An unclean filter limits airflow, making your system work harder and reducing its cooling capacity.
  • Coil Cleaning: Indoor and outside coils can collect dust and debris. Clean them annually using a fin comb and a mild cleansing solution. Disregarded coils drastically lower effectiveness.
  • Condensate Drain Assessment: A blocked drain line can lead to water damage and mold growth. Flush it out with a wet/dry vacuum or a stiff wire.
  • Fin Straightening: Bent fins on the outside system restrict air flow. Utilize a fin comb to gently straighten them.
  • Expert Tune-Up: Schedule an annual examination by a certified technician. They can recognize and attend to prospective issues before they escalate into expensive repair work.

Expense of Air Conditioner Repair and Aspects

Ever question why that relatively basic AC repair ends up costing more than you initially prepared for? It's seldom a straightforward circumstance. You see, the last expense is a complex computation affected by various aspects, some apparent and others lurking underneath the surface.

Translating the Expense Equation.

Consider the diagnostic fee. Think of it as the investigator work required to discover the root of the problem. This cost covers the professional's time and competence in identifying what ails your cooling system. Is it a small problem or a major malfunction? This preliminary assessment sets the stage for the whole repair work process. Simply a few days ago, a friend complained about a "basic" repair that ballooned in cost; turns out, a rusty coil, concealed from plain sight, was the real offender.

The Cost of Parts and Labor.

Then comes the cost of replacement parts. Depending on the age and design of your air conditioner system, finding the ideal parts can be a breeze or a real scavenger hunt. Outdated parts might need sourcing from specialized suppliers, which can significantly increase the price. And let's not forget labor expenses. Experienced specialists aren't inexpensive, and for great factor. They possess the understanding and experience to precisely diagnose and repair complicated concerns, guaranteeing your air conditioner runs effectively and efficiently. The more detailed the repair, the more time it will take, equating into greater labor expenditures. The particular intricacy of the a/c system and its elements are vital to bear in mind when considering the cost.

Surprise Issues and Considerations.

That's not all. In some cases, what appears to be a simple repair unearths a cascade of unexpected issues. A leaking refrigerant line might result in compressor damage, needing extra repair work and even a total system replacement. These unforeseen twists can drastically affect the final cost. Availability plays a function. Is your a/c unit quickly available, or is it stashed in a hard-to-reach location? Difficult access can increase labor time and, subsequently, the general cost. When the professional has to almost carry out balancings to reach the unit, that adds to the time and difficulty.
